We taught bees a simple number language – and they got it

  • Written by Scarlett Howard, Postdoctoral research fellow, Université de Toulouse III - Paul Sabatier
We taught bees a simple number language – and they got itMaybe the differences between human and non-human animals are not as great as we might previously have thought.from www.shutterstock.com

Most children learn that written numbers represent quantities in pre-school or junior primary school.

Now our new study shows that honeybees too can learn to match symbols and numerosities, much like we humans do...
